    Reactivity of Ph2(2-C5H4N)PSe towards Ru3(CO)12 and mononuclear MCl2(PhCN)2 (M=Pd or Pt) complexes
    摘要:
    The behavior of the Ph-2(2-C5H4N)PSe ligand in the reactions with Ru-3(CO)(12) and the mononuclear complexes MCl2(PhCN)(2) (M=Pd or Pt) has been investigated. The reaction with Ru-3(CO)(12) is characterized by P=Se bond cleavage, affording the 48-electron compound [Ru-3(mu(3)-Se)(mu-PPh2)(2)(mu-C5H4N)(mu(3)-C5H4N)(CO)(6)] (1), the open triangular 50-electron nido clusters [Ru-3(mu(3)-Se),(CO)(9-n) {P(2-C5H4N)Ph-2}] (2 and 3, for n=1 and 2, respectively) and the octahedral 62-electron closo cluster [Ru-4(mu(4)-Se)(2)(CO){mu-P, N-Ph-2(2-C5H4N)P}] (4). The cluster 1 derives by the multiple fragmentation of two phosphine ligands on the metal triangle involving the P=Se and P-C bond cleavages. The molecular structure of 4 shows a short Ru...P non-bonding separation that can be viewed as a preliminary step towards the P-C bond cleavage. In the reactions with MCl2(PhCN)(2) (M=Pd, Pt) Ph-2(2-C5H4N)PSe remains intact affording mononuclear neutral complexes of the type MCl2{N,Se-Ph-2(2-C5H4N)PSe}. The crystal structure of the palladium derivative 5 has been determined by X-ray diffraction methods. (C) 2003 Elsevier Science B.V. All rights reserved.
